I jumped from credit risk to CRE at a MM bank. I started in Credit Risk out of college interfacing with the OCC and was able to move to Commercial Real Estate lending. It took some internal networking but I was able to pull it off in just over a year. Networking is key. A contact of mine was in the CRE group and gave me a heads up when a position opened up.
